    For Those Running or Plan on Running Big Cams

    I have been doing some extensive research on rocker arm wear resulting from large cam profiles. Heres what my rocker arms looked like after 5-7k miles on JUN cams. Mostly this happens to H22's but I kept finding other cars that run flat tappet camshafts are having similar problems. This...
